Transaction 473958963c565ecbdf360bb3d14fa894a39f134b818ec2293760b97857bc2d51
1 Input
1 Output
-
473958963c565ecbdf360bb3d14fa894a39f134b818ec2293760b97857bc2d51:0
- value
- 200294
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 16858ab01bb6c6660030e4a090528f140eb48a5c539f7b142a546364b9ea9535
- address
- bc1pz6zc4vqmkmrxvqpsujsfq550zs8tfzju2w0hk9p2233kfw02j56ssy8tmz